Dynamiques de classe et efficacité scolaire

2003

The present research aims at describing the efficiency of teaching practices involved in dynamic "teaching-training" processes. Our main approach consisted in relating in-class-monitoring to the results of knowledge-acquisition by pupils so as to better explain through what means the pupils’ knowledge and competence are acquired. At a theoretical level this implies combining the "process-product" paradigm along with the "ecological" paradigm [ 1]. Results obtained indicate that bringing together the analysis of teaching practices with the evaluation of their impact "which are still limited to an exploratory stage" are a method well-worth pursuing. Idéologie et production de connaissances : le poids de l'inspection

2013

Il s'agit d'identifier dans quelle mesure l'inspection, en EPS, est productrice de connaissances (notamment dans les revues professionnelles) et/ou d'idéologie(s), de la fin des années 1950 au début des années 1990. Nous montrons que si une déontologie de neutralité est largement partagée, les postures et actions de l'inspection permettent de dégager des sensibilités différentes (notamment en terme de rapport aux pratiques sportives extra-scolaires et à leur "démocratisation").

Poisoning histories in the Italian renaissance: The case of Pico Della Mirandola and Angelo Poliziano.

2018

Giovanni Pico della Mirandola and Angelo Poliziano were two of the most important humanists of the Italian Renaissance. They died suddenly in 1494 and their deaths have been for centuries a subject of debate. The exhumation of their remains offered the opportunity to study the cause of their death through a multidisciplinary research project. Anthropological analyses, together with documentary evidences, radiocarbon dating and ancient DNA analysis supported the identification of the remains attributed to Pico. Electrifying Organic Synthesis

2018

Abstract The direct synthetic organic use of electricity is currently experiencing a renaissance. More synthetically oriented laboratories working in this area are exploiting both novel and more traditional concepts, paving the way to broader applications of this niche technology. As only electrons serve as reagents, the generation of reagent waste is efficiently avoided. Moreover, stoichiometric reagents can be regenerated and allow a transformation to be conducted in an electrocatalytic fashion. 3D shape recognition and matching for intelligent computer vision systems

2018

This thesis concerns recognition and matching of 3D shapes for intelligent computer vision systems. It describes two main contributions to this domain. The first contribution is an implementation of a new shape descriptor built on the basis of the spectral geometry of the Laplace-Beltrami operator; we propose an Advanced Global Point Signature (AGPS). This descriptor exploits the intrinsic structure of the object and organizes its information in an efficient way. In addition, AGPS is extremely compact since only a few eigenpairs were necessary to obtain an accurate shape description.
